大数据已经成为当今世界的重要资源。各行各业都在积极拥抱大数据,以期从中挖掘价值,提升竞争力。对于初入大数据领域的人来说,如何入门成为了一道难题。本文将为您梳理大数据入门的路径,帮助您开启这段充满挑战与机遇的旅程。
一、了解大数据的基本概念
1. 什么是大数据?
大数据是指规模巨大、类型繁多、价值密度低的数据集合。它具有4V特点:Volume(大量)、Velocity(高速)、Variety(多样)和Value(价值)。
2. 大数据的应用领域
大数据在各个领域都有广泛应用,如金融、医疗、教育、交通、物流等。以下列举几个典型应用案例:
(1)金融领域:通过大数据分析,金融机构可以更好地了解客户需求,提高风险控制能力,实现精准营销。
(2)医疗领域:大数据可以帮助医生了解疾病发展趋势,为患者提供个性化治疗方案。
(3)教育领域:大数据可以帮助教育机构了解学生需求,优化教育资源分配,提高教育质量。
二、学习大数据相关技术
1. 编程语言
(1)Python:Python是一门广泛应用于大数据领域的编程语言,具有简洁、易学、功能强大的特点。
(2)Java:Java在大型企业级项目中具有广泛的应用,是大数据开发的重要语言之一。
2. 大数据框架
(1)Hadoop:Hadoop是一个开源的大数据处理框架,用于分布式存储和处理大规模数据集。
(2)Spark:Spark是一个高性能的分布式计算引擎,支持多种数据处理模式,如批处理、流处理和交互式查询。
3. 数据库技术
(1)关系型数据库:如MySQL、Oracle等。
(2)NoSQL数据库:如MongoDB、Redis等。
4. 数据挖掘与分析工具
(1)Elasticsearch:Elasticsearch是一个基于Lucene的搜索引擎,可以快速进行大数据搜索。
(2)Tableau:Tableau是一款数据可视化工具,可以帮助用户将数据以图表形式直观地展示出来。
三、掌握大数据实战技能
1. 数据采集与处理
(1)数据采集:了解各种数据源,如API、爬虫等。
(2)数据处理:熟悉数据清洗、数据转换、数据存储等技能。
2. 数据分析
(1)数据挖掘:掌握聚类、分类、关联规则等数据挖掘算法。
(2)统计分析:了解描述性统计、推断性统计等统计方法。
3. 数据可视化
(1)图表设计:学习如何设计美观、易读的图表。
(2)交互式可视化:了解D3.js、Highcharts等可视化库。
四、加入大数据社群,拓展人脉
1. 加入大数据论坛:如CSDN、51CTO等。
2. 关注大数据技术博客:如InfoQ、CSDN博客等。
3. 参加大数据相关活动:如技术沙龙、行业峰会等。
大数据时代,入门之路充满挑战,但同时也蕴藏着无限机遇。通过学习相关技术、掌握实战技能、拓展人脉,相信您一定能在大数据领域取得优异成绩。祝您在入门之旅中一帆风顺!